介绍

Linux是一种开源的操作系统,是许多计算机科学家和程序员使用的首选系统,他们喜欢用它来开发和执行程序。在Linux上,程序员可以用不同的编程语言来编写代码,比如C语言,它是Linux上最常用的编程语言之一。因此,本文将介绍如何在Linux上运行C程序。

C编译器

在Linux上运行C程序需要安装一个叫做C编译器的软件。在Linux上,有很多种C编译器可供选择,其中一种是GNU编译器。GNU编译器是一种免费的编译器,是Linux系统中最常用的编译器之一。如果你的系统中没有安装GNU编译器,可以使用以下命令在终端中进行安装:

sudo apt-get install gcc

在安装后,你可以在终端中输入以下命令吗来检查是否成功安装:

gcc -v

如果安装成功,则终端会返回版本信息。这表明你可以开始编写和运行C程序了。

编写和运行C程序

编写C程序需要使用一个文本编辑器,例如GNU Emacs或Vim。打开一个文本编辑器,创建一个新的文件。你可以使用以下命令在终端中创建一个新的文件:

(VI编辑器)vi test.c
(Emacs编辑器) emacs test.c

在新的文件中,你可以写下你的C程序。下面是一个简单的示例:

#include 

int main() {
    printf("Hello World!");
    return 0;
}

在保存文件之前,你需要用gcc命令来编译C程序。打开终端并在终端中输入以下命令来编译C程序:

gcc test.c -o test

其中,“-o”选项将指定编译器将生成的可执行文件的名称。如果没有指定名称,编译器将自动分配名称。在上面的命令中,“test”是指定的可执行文件的名称。

编译成功后,你可以运行C程序。在终端中输入以下命令来运行:

./test

正确情况下,终端会输出“Hello World!”。

总结

在Linux上运行C程序需要了解一些基本的概念,例如C编译器和编译C程序的过程。在本文中,我们介绍了GNU编译器的安装以及如何使用C编译器来编译和运行C程序。现在,你已经学会了如何在Linux上启动C编程之旅。希望这篇文章对你有所帮助!